1. Fine Dining Etiquette in Bali

Bali is relaxed, but fine dining venues maintain certain standards to ensure a premium experience. Here are the essentials:

βœ” Arrive On Time

Many fine dining restaurants operate with a set menu timeline.
For experiences like Gajah Putih β€” where dishes match theatre cues β€” timing is everything.

βœ” Inform Dietary Restrictions in Advance

Set menus are carefully curated. If you have allergies or dietary needs, let the restaurant know when booking.

βœ” Keep Your Voice Soft

Fine dining environments are designed to be intimate.
Respect the ambience for other guests.

βœ” Respect Artistic Elements

If the restaurant offers a performance (like LINGKARAN or MALAM at Gajah Putih), avoid interrupting or approaching the stage.

2. Fine Dining Dresscode in Bali

Most fine dining restaurants follow a smart casual to elegant casual dresscode.

Recommended Wear

For Men:
  • shirts or polos
  • long trousers
  • closed shoes
For Women:
  • dresses
  • elegant tops
  • jumpsuits
  • stylish footwear

Avoid

  • beachwear
  • tank tops
  • board shorts
  • flip-flops

At Gajah Putih

Dresscode: Elegant Casual
The lighting, theatre, and ambience are visually stunning β€” dressing well enhances the overall experience (and the photos!).

4. Extra Tips to Maximize Your Fine Dining Experience

βœ” Don’t Arrive Too Full

Most set menus range from 7–11 courses. Arrive with space to enjoy everything.

βœ” Enjoy the Pace

Fine dining is meant to be slow, thoughtful, and immersive.

βœ” Ask Questions

Bali’s fine dining staff are friendly and knowledgeable β€” feel free to ask about ingredients, pairings, and inspiration behind each dish.
